Key Business Casual Shoes for Every Occasion

Navigating the realm of business casual footwear can feel seem a daunting task. You want to strike that perfect balance between professionalism and ease. Luckily, there are some essential shoe styles that can seamlessly transition from the boardroom to after-hours events.

A classic pair of brogues in brown is a essential for any business casual wardrobe. They can be dressed up with a suit or down with chinos. For a more modern look, consider monk straps. These styles add a touch of individuality while still maintaining a professional aura.

When it comes to athletic shoes, choose clean and minimalist designs in neutral tones. Avoid anything too flashy or athleisure-inspired. Canvas sneakers can be a practical option for casual days at the office.

To complete, don't forget about ankle boots. Chelsea or chukka boots in leather are a great option for cooler weather and can be seamlessly incorporated into a business casual outfit.

Remember, the key to success is finding shoes that fit well, make you feel confident, and complement your personal style.

Embracing the Art of Business Professional Attire

In the dynamic realm of business, first impressions are paramount. Demonstrating an image of professionalism through attire is essential for success. A well-curated wardrobe not only instills confidence but also cultivates a sense of authority and respect.

Adhering to industry standards while adding your personal style can create a harmonious balance. Opt for classic garments in neutral tones, such as navy, gray, and black. Invest in high-quality fabrics that are both durable and flattering.

Accessories can enhance your professional look. A minimalist watch, a tasteful tie or scarf, and tasteful jewelry can add a touch of personality without overshadowing from the overall look.

Remember, business attire is an ongoing journey. Stay aware of current trends while remaining true to your own aesthetic.
